Transaction 3fc509654200fc2fa29636d3b6089b687e6e73e2f65195dbb89daad97a382db7
1 Input
1 Output
-
3fc509654200fc2fa29636d3b6089b687e6e73e2f65195dbb89daad97a382db7:0
- value
- 58786
- script pubkey
- OP_0 OP_PUSHBYTES_20 3d1037a3850cdc54c3130df1374f586632f8298c
- address
- bc1q85gr0gu9pnw9fscnphcnwn6cvce0s2vvar4893